云MySQL數據庫的擴展性是非常好的,它提供了多種方式來滿足業務需求的增長。以下是對云MySQL數據庫擴展性的詳細介紹:
云MySQL數據庫的擴展性特點
- 自動水平和垂直擴展:云MySQL數據庫支持根據業務需求自動擴展存儲容量和處理能力,無需手動調整硬件設備。
- 彈性伸縮:能夠根據負載情況自動調整數據庫實例的規模,以提供更好的性能和響應能力。
- 靈活的業務擴展:用戶可以根據業務需求隨時調整數據庫的配置和容量,而無需擔心硬件采購和部署的問題。
如何確保云MySQL數據庫的高性能和可擴展性
- 選擇合適的實例類型:根據應用程序的需求選擇適當的實例類型,例如CPU、內存和存儲容量。
- 使用主從復制:通過設置主從復制,可以將讀操作分發到多個從服務器上,從而提高性能。
- 優化數據庫配置:調整MySQL的配置參數,如
innodb_buffer_pool_size
、innodb_log_file_size
等,以提高性能。
- 使用分區表和索引:對于大型表,使用分區表來提高查詢性能,并為經常用于查詢條件的列創建索引。
- 定期備份和監控:定期備份數據庫以防止數據丟失,并監控數據庫的性能指標,以便及時發現和解決問題。
- 使用負載均衡器:在云環境中,使用負載均衡器來分發請求到多個數據庫實例,以提高可用性和擴展性。
云MySQL數據庫的優缺點
- 優點:包括可擴展性、高可用性、自動備份和恢復、安全性、靈活性等。
- 缺點:可能涉及成本、網絡延遲、數據安全風險、依賴第三方服務商等。
綜上所述,云MySQL數據庫在擴展性方面表現出色,能夠靈活應對業務需求的增長。同時,通過合理的選擇和配置,可以確保數據庫的高性能和可擴展性。